The type of nuclear division that leads to the formation of haploid gametes in both males and females

The type of nuclear division that leads to the formation of haploid gametes in both males and females is called meiosis.

In meiosis the gametes will only have half of the origin cells genes. That's why it called haploid. It different with mitosis where the result is diploid(paired chromosome).
